the thing i love about how haikyuu represents yachi hitoka's relationship with her mother is that they never present her mother as being wrong for the way she treats hitoka, just that the type of "tough love" she values is not always what hitoka needs to hear.
eg: the audience is immediately reassured (in the conversation between hitokas mum and her coworker) that she doesnt mean to come across as cold, just that she believes hitoka needs to become "tougher" (self assured) and that if that small piece of dejection is enough to make her not persue becoming the manager of the vball club, then she was never that passionate about it to begin with.
and this is shown to be true! despite this momentary upset from her mother, hitoka continues to try her best to get to know the vball club members and help them before officially being appointed as a manager. BUT she is still on the fence because of her own insecurities which were compounded by her mother.
hitokas mother is giving her advice, GOOD advice even, but the miscommunication comes from the fact that it is not what hitoka really needs to hear.
hitokas first piece of actual encouragement of course comes from kiyoko in that lovely scene they get in the changing room. while hitokas mothers advice was "if youre not 100% sure about something, you cant give it your all" (sound advice for someone with less anxiety maybe) kiyoko tells her "its okay not to be sure just yet, but if you give things a try, you could find yourself giving it your all anyway" . this is the first step for hitoka realising that her mothers words are incomplete (not wrong, just not the full picture)
welcome hinata to the picture. he WANTS her to be the new manager and he likes her as a person! his words of ENCOURAGEMENT are what finally drives her to realise that she CAN do something for herself and she is ABLE to do things outside of her comfort zone.
and once yachi is IN? her mother is there with the same philosophy she has always had, but this time hitoka's mindset has changed, she is READY to be driven forward . "thats not going to work, it doesnt stand out at all. who is your target audience, what are you trying to show?" the advice again is given in that "cold" tone, but now we as the audience , and finally hitoka, understand the true meaning of what is being said. its not to belittle or discourage, but to promote introspection.
the thing i love about this dynamic is that it is very realistic to the way a lot of parents thinm they need to encourage their children. its not necessarily incorrect, just wrongly timed.
hitoka was only able to come into her own AFTER being encouraged, as it gave her the CONFIDENCE to introspect the way her mother was trying to get her to do. in fact i would say it means that hitokas mum thinks quite highly of her daughter, believing she had the confidence to introspect all on her own without blatant encouragement needed
all this is to say that basically i love the dynamic between those two and that hitoka was able to get the encouragement she needed to become a more self assured person, which i think allowed her to come to a better understanding of her mothers words and own form of advice
a lesser show would have had hitoka just realising her mum was right all along! or would have demonised her mum for being too harsh! but i much prefer the realistic showcase of conflicting wants and needs, and that both sides of advice can be helpful or harmful depending on the person.
